Sam Walton

Known as the Bargain Basement Billionaire, Samuel Moore Walton single-handedly built Walt Mart into one of the biggest retailer stores in the world shaping up America’s shopping experience. Walton started his journey when he took a sales trainee job at the JC Penney store in Iowa. His work experience made him realize how customers should be treated right. After his successful business venture with a Ben Franklin variety store and lost its lease, Walton decided to put up a shop in a store in Bentonville, Arkansas. With his talent in handling a business, he managed to open his first Wal-Mart in Rogers, Arkansas. The retail store was a big hit to the customers, and through time, with careful decisions and plans, it became the nation’s biggest retailer.
